July stats are out, so we can finally see how much of a difference APHE made.
Valentine XI:
Spoiler

Pre-APHE

Post-APHE
So the winrate went from 53% to 62%, while the KD went from 1.61 to 2.6. I think this BR increase was pretty justified, though I personally don’t think it’s going to do much as I’ve never played it at 2.7 only 3.0 anyway.

A33 (“Excelsior”):
I always thought this vehicle was due for a BR increase anyway, but Gaijin love to reward players who own these vehicles. See the T18E2 as well. So it going to 4.3 made absolute sense. Pretty crazy though it went from 64.7% to 71.1% winrate even with the lack of a good 4.0 lineup. The KD as well went from 2.84 to 3.93. I suspect the A33 will also go up to 4.7 in future, hopefully Gaijin fix the mantlet thickness which at minimum should be the same as Crusader/Cromwell/Churchill.
Churchill VII/Crocodile:
I think there might be something wrong with the Crocodiles stats on StatShark as nothing moved at all, but I imagine the jump was more than the TT Mk VII. The Mk VII WR went from 58.1% to 64.7%, while the KD jumped from 1.9 to 2.97. So I can understand why Gaijin uptiered it. I can only hope it doesn’t get dragged up further.
